mirror of
https://github.com/willmiao/ComfyUI-Lora-Manager.git
synced 2026-06-22 11:21:15 -03:00
- group_by_model dedup now counts versions per group and attaches version_count; respects update_flag_strategy (same_base) by sub-grouping on base_model - Card footer shows clickable 'x versions' link instead of version name when grouped (hides HIGH/LOW badges); clicking triggers View Local Versions without page reload - Added 'Local Versions' sort option (versions_count), auto-hidden when group_by_model is off - Sort preference is saved/restored separately for normal and grouped modes - VLM flow (triggerVlmView, clearCustomFilter) uses resetAndReload() via API instead of window.location.reload() - Fixed cache mutation bug: version_count is now set on a shallow copy, not the cached dict, preventing stale version_count leaking into VLM responses - i18n: all 9 locale files translated
67 lines
2.2 KiB
CSS
67 lines
2.2 KiB
CSS
/* Import Base Styles */
|
|
@import 'base.css';
|
|
|
|
/* Import Layout */
|
|
@import 'layout.css';
|
|
|
|
/* Import Components */
|
|
@import 'components/header.css';
|
|
@import 'components/banner.css';
|
|
@import 'components/card.css';
|
|
@import 'components/modal/_base.css';
|
|
@import 'components/modal/delete-modal.css';
|
|
@import 'components/modal/update-modal.css';
|
|
@import 'components/modal/settings-modal.css';
|
|
@import 'components/modal/doctor-modal.css';
|
|
@import 'components/modal/help-modal.css';
|
|
@import 'components/modal/relink-civitai-modal.css';
|
|
@import 'components/modal/example-access-modal.css';
|
|
@import 'components/modal/support-modal.css';
|
|
@import 'components/modal/download-modal.css';
|
|
@import 'components/toast.css';
|
|
@import 'components/loading.css';
|
|
@import 'components/menu.css';
|
|
@import 'components/lora-modal/lora-modal.css';
|
|
@import 'components/lora-modal/description.css';
|
|
@import 'components/lora-modal/tag.css';
|
|
@import 'components/lora-modal/preset-tags.css';
|
|
@import 'components/lora-modal/showcase.css';
|
|
@import 'components/lora-modal/triggerwords.css';
|
|
@import 'components/lora-modal/versions.css';
|
|
@import 'components/shared/edit-metadata.css';
|
|
@import 'components/search-filter.css';
|
|
@import 'components/bulk.css';
|
|
@import 'components/shared.css';
|
|
@import 'components/filter-indicator.css';
|
|
@import 'components/initialization.css';
|
|
@import 'components/progress-panel.css';
|
|
@import 'components/duplicates.css'; /* Add duplicates component */
|
|
|
|
@import 'components/statistics.css'; /* Add statistics component */
|
|
@import 'components/sidebar.css'; /* Add sidebar component */
|
|
@import 'components/media-viewer.css';
|
|
@import 'components/metadata-refresh-result.css';
|
|
|
|
.initialization-notice {
|
|
display: flex;
|
|
justify-content: center;
|
|
align-items: center;
|
|
min-height: 200px;
|
|
margin: var(--space-3) 0;
|
|
padding: var(--space-3);
|
|
background: var(--lora-surface);
|
|
border: 1px solid var(--lora-border);
|
|
border-radius: var(--border-radius-base);
|
|
text-align: center;
|
|
}
|
|
|
|
/* Reuse existing loading-spinner styles */
|
|
.initialization-notice .loading-spinner {
|
|
margin-bottom: var(--space-2);
|
|
}
|
|
|
|
/* Hide versions_count sort option when group-by-model is off */
|
|
body:not(.group-by-model) .sort-option-versions-count {
|
|
display: none;
|
|
}
|